Non-stop flights to Juneau (JNU)
Juneau International Airport is a medium sized airport in United States. It is a domestic airport. Currently, there are 16 domestic flights to Juneau.
On this page
All direct flights to Juneau Top 200 flights with a stopover Airlines flying to Juneau Best time to visit Juneau Business Class flights Domestic flights Alternative airports FAQThis month, there are 1,142 flights arriving at Juneau Airport, which are 38 flights per day or 2 flights per hour.
The most frequently departed flights to Juneau are routes from Haines (HNS) in United States and Hoonah (HNH), also in United States. These two routes together are operated 357 times this month, and make up for 31% of all monthly arrivals at Juneau International Airport.
The longest flight to Juneau JNU is departing from Seattle / Tacoma (SEA). This non-stop flight takes around 2 hours and 38 minutes and covers a distance of 907 miles (1,460 km).

Domestic flights to Juneau
Flights from United States to Juneau
There are lots of domestic flights to Juneau (JNU). 16 airports in United States have direct flights to the airport.
From Anchorage, direct flights are offered by Alaska (Oneworld).
From Angoon, you can fly non-stop with Air Excursions or Alaska Seaplane. This is a seasonal route that starts in April and ends in October.
From Elfin Cove, you can fly non-stop to Juneau with Alaska Seaplane. This is a seasonal route that starts in April and ends in October.
From Gustavus, you can fly non-stop with Air Excursions or Alaska (Oneworld). This is a seasonal route that starts in April and ends in August.
From Haines, Hoonah and Kake, all direct flights to Juneau are operated by Air Excursions and Alaska Seaplane.
From Ketchikan, you can fly non-stop with Air Excursions or Alaska (Oneworld).
From Klawock, you can fly non-stop with Air Excursions or Alaska Seaplane. This is a seasonal route that starts in April and ends in October.
From Pelican, the only airline with direct flights is Alaska Seaplane. This is a seasonal route that starts in April and ends in October.
From Petersburg, direct flights are offered by Alaska (Oneworld).
From Seattle / Tacoma, you can fly non-stop with Alaska (Oneworld) or Delta (SkyTeam).
From Sitka, direct flights are offered by Air Excursions, Alaska (Oneworld) and Alaska Seaplane.
From Skagway and Tenakee Springs, you can fly with Air Excursions and Alaska Seaplane.
From Yakutat, the only airline with direct flights is Alaska (Oneworld).
